The Elbow Defense (Couter) by an unknown artist is a metallic piece of armor. The defense is roughly teardrop shaped with the pointed end facing down. It is made of metal that appears to be weathered and worn, with visible signs of aging and use. The surface displays a mottled appearance with darker spots and patches scattered across it. A strap and rivets are on the left side near the top. The background of the image is gray.
